Bospar’s strategic media outreach and storytelling around Samuel Merritt University’s Oakland expansion generated impressive coverage, elevating awareness of the new campus and the community impact. Our team’s efforts promoting the opening and the exciting speakers led to coverage from every broadcast station in the Bay Area. The campaign leveraged both local and national outlets to maximize visibility, resulting in strong engagement and reach.

Bospar’s efforts also helped drive web traffic and user signups for the client. During the Oakland campus grand opening, the client saw a nearly 10% increase in website traffic compared to the prior week. The client’s campus hub pages also saw sharp increases in users and new users.
“Bospar has delivered millions of media impressions, which have contributed to expanding Samuel Merritt University’s visibility and reputation at a pivotal moment for both our institution and the City of Oakland. With their strategic counsel and media expertise, we’ve been able to shine a spotlight on our new downtown campus and the state-of-the-art simulation centers that will train the next generation of healthcare professionals. Just as importantly, Bospar has helped us connect our mission to create a larger community conversation, securing coverage that underscores SMU’s role in addressing post-COVID health disparities, mental health needs, and even complex issues like human trafficking. From broadcast features on NBC Bay Area, KTVU and KCBS Radio to national and vertical outlets such as Forbes Vetted, Health and MSN, Bospar has amplified our leadership as a top-tier health sciences institution and as a committed partner in building a healthier, stronger Oakland.”
— Gina Squara, Vice President, Strategic Growth and Marketing, SMU
